About this school

Shepherd Hill Regional High is a State/Public serving high age pupils, located in Dudley, Worcester County. The school has 923 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Dudley-Charlton Reg school district. It serves grades 9โ€“12 in a suburban setting. The school employs 66.5 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 13.9:1. 62% of students are proficient in reading. 62% are proficient in maths. The four-year graduation rate is 95%. The school offers 12 AP courses, dual enrollment, a gifted and talented program.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Enrollment & staffing

Shepherd Hill Regional High enrolls 923 students across grades 9โ€“12. The student body is 48% male and 52% female. A teaching staff of 66.5 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 13.9:1.

Student demographics

By race and ethnicity, the student body is 82% White, 11% Hispanic or Latino and 2.6% Black or African American.

School district: Dudley-Charlton Reg

Shepherd Hill Regional High is one of 7 schools in Dudley-Charlton Reg, based in Dudley, Massachusetts. The district serves 3,476 students district-wide and employs 259 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 923 students, Shepherd Hill Regional High is larger than the district average of about 497 students per school.
